Jump to content
  • 0

Crear un lanzador de terminal en Lubuntu (script)


Question

Hola, soy nuevo en Linux y ando bastante perdido. Asique si alguien me pudiese ayudar, paso por paso, se lo agradecería. Uso Lubuntu con LXDE.
 
El caso es que quiero crear un script ejecutable de terminal en el escritorio, que al darle doble click en escritorio, me habra la aplicación terminal (Lxterminal) y me ejecute el comando "sudo nast -m" automáticamente.
Yo lo que intento es crear un script (script.sh) cuyo código es:
 

#!/bin/bash
sudo nast -m
 
Pero al ejecutarlo, con doble click, no me responde (no hace nada). He seleccionado "Abrir con LxTerminal"
 
Si me pudieseis ayudar, os estaría muy agradecido (No tengo experiencias anteriores con Linux, asique mis conocimientos son muy limitados)
 
Un saludo
Link to post
Share on other sites

5 answers to this question

Recommended Posts

  • 0

Un saludo, intenta con:

#!/bin/bash
lxterminal --command "sudo nast -m"

lo guardas por ejemplo con el nombre milanzador.sh en thu $HOME

 

desde una terminal le das persios de ejecucion con el comand:

chmod +x $HOME/milanzador.sh

y listo con eso ya podrias lanzar ese comando en lxterminal.

 

Espero que te sirva

 

Un Saludo

Link to post
Share on other sites
  • 0

Un saludo, intenta con:

#!/bin/bash
lxterminal --command "sudo nast -m"

lo guardas por ejemplo con el nombre milanzador.sh en thu $HOME

 

desde una terminal le das persios de ejecucion con el comand:

chmod +x $HOME/milanzador.sh

y listo con eso ya podrias lanzar ese comando en lxterminal.

 

Espero que te sirva

 

Un Saludo

Muchas gracias por tu respuesta. En efecto, me ha funcionado tal y como dices. Se me abre el Lxterminal, y se me ejecuta el comando. Pero el problema es que al terminar, se me cierra el Lxterminal, algun comando mas que se pueda añadir al script para que esto no suceda?

 

Un millon

Link to post
Share on other sites
  • 0

Un saludo, intenta con:

#!/bin/bash
lxterminal --command "sudo nast -m"

lo guardas por ejemplo con el nombre milanzador.sh en thu $HOME

 

desde una terminal le das persios de ejecucion con el comand:

chmod +x $HOME/milanzador.sh

y listo con eso ya podrias lanzar ese comando en lxterminal.

 

Espero que te sirva

 

Un Saludo

 

Bienvenido seas , y gracias por ayudar.

Link to post
Share on other sites
  • 0

 

Un saludo, intenta con:

#!/bin/bash
lxterminal --command "sudo nast -m"

lo guardas por ejemplo con el nombre milanzador.sh en thu $HOME

 

desde una terminal le das persios de ejecucion con el comand:

chmod +x $HOME/milanzador.sh

y listo con eso ya podrias lanzar ese comando en lxterminal.

 

Espero que te sirva

 

Un Saludo

Muchas gracias por tu respuesta. En efecto, me ha funcionado tal y como dices. Se me abre el Lxterminal, y se me ejecuta el comando. Pero el problema es que al terminar, se me cierra el Lxterminal, algun comando mas que se pueda añadir al script para que esto no suceda?

 

Un millon

 

 

 

Que bueno que te sirvio, no tengo idea si se puede hacer lo que tu dices.

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
×
×
  • Create New...